conceal-lib-js is the one-stop npm package for every cryptographic function used by
conceal-web-wallet. Heavy operations are compiled from Rust to WebAssembly;
CnUtils-style helpers, Keccak, and string-heavy work stay in plain JavaScript
(and TweetNaCl CN extensions) where that wins on latency.

import { mnemonic, random, cn, cnutils, crypto, cypher } from "concealjs";Works with Vite, webpack, Rollup, and Node when your toolchain resolves the package import condition. WASM is loaded by the bundler automatically.
Projects that serve TypeScript/AMD with RequireJS and no app bundler should vendor a prebuilt copy into the repo:
npm install concealjs
npx concealjs --prebuildBy default this writes src/lib/concealjs/ (single concealjs.js ~260 KB with WASM inlined, plus .d.ts files). Use a custom directory if needed:
npx concealjs --prebuild --out src/lib/concealjsCLI help: npx concealjs --help.
Verify concealjs.d.ts in included in src/lib/concealjs
If you used --out, change the concealjs path to match that folder.
Add before RequireJS:
<script src="lib/concealjs/concealjs.js"></script>Load and use the global API:
const result = concealjs.crypto.derive_secret_key(derivation, out_index, sec);Implemented in plain JS — no WASM boundary overhead. Benchmarked at ~2.8× faster than the equivalent Rust WASM build.

All functions accept and return hex strings (lowercase). Function names match
conceal-web-wallet/src/model/Cn.tsexactly.
| Function | Parameters | Returns | C++ reference |
|---|---|---|---|
cn_fast_hash(data_hex) |
hex string (any length) | 64-char hex (Keccak-256) | hash-ops.h: cn_fast_hash |
hash_to_scalar(data_hex) |
hex string (any length) | 64-char hex scalar | cn_fast_hash then sc_reduce32 |
All scalars are 64-char hex (32-byte little-endian integers mod Ed25519 group order l).
| Function | Parameters | Returns |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
sc_reduce32(hex) |
64-char hex | 64-char hex | Reduce mod l |
sc_add(a, b) |
two 64-char hex scalars | 64-char hex | (a + b) mod l |
sc_sub(a, b) |
two 64-char hex scalars | 64-char hex | (a − b) mod l |
sc_mulsub(a, b, c) |
three 64-char hex scalars | 64-char hex | (c − a·b) mod l |
sc_0() |
— | 64-char hex "00…00" |
Zero scalar |
sc_check(hex) |
64-char hex | boolean |
true if scalar is canonical (< l) |
All points are 64-char hex (32-byte compressed Edwards y format).
| Function | Parameters | Returns |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
ge_scalarmult_base(scalar_hex) |
64-char hex scalar | 64-char hex point | scalar × B — also serves as sec_key_to_pub |
ge_scalarmult(point_hex, scalar_hex) |
64-char hex point + scalar | 64-char hex point | scalar × point |
ge_mul8(point_hex) |
64-char hex point | 64-char hex point | Multiply by cofactor 8 |
ge_add(a_hex, b_hex) |
two 64-char hex points | 64-char hex point | Edwards point addition |
ge_tobytes(point_hex) |
64-char hex point | 64-char hex point | Validates point is on curve |
ge_p3_tobytes(point_hex) |
64-char hex point | 64-char hex point | Alias for ge_tobytes |
ge_frombytes_vartime(point_hex) |
64-char hex point | 64-char hex point | Decompress + re-compress (validates) |
| Function | Parameters | Returns | C++ reference |
|---|---|---|---|
generate_keys(seed_hex) |
64-char hex seed | { sec: hex, pub: hex } |
sc_reduce32(seed) + ge_scalarmult_base(sec) |
generate_key_derivation(pub_hex, sec_hex) |
two 64-char hex keys | 64-char hex derivation | 8 × (sec · pub_point) — DH shared key |
derive_public_key(deriv_hex, index, base_pub_hex) |
derivation + u32 index + 64-char hex pub | 64-char hex pub | base_pub + H(derivation‖varint(index)) · B |
derive_secret_key(deriv_hex, index, base_sec_hex) |
derivation + u32 index + 64-char hex sec | 64-char hex sec | sc_add(base_sec, H(derivation‖varint(index))) |
generate_key_image(pub_hex, sec_hex) |
two 64-char hex keys | 64-char hex key image | sec × hash_to_ec(pub) via internal ge_p3 |
hash_to_ec160(pub_hex) |
64-char hex public key | 320-char hex (160-byte ge_p3) |
Wallet CnUtils.hash_to_ec — ring sigs, ge_scalarmult on GE_P3 |
hash_to_ec32(pub_hex) |
64-char hex public key | 64-char hex compressed point | Wallet hash_to_ec_2 — ge_double_scalarmult_postcomp_vartime, etc. |
hash_to_ec(pub_hex) |
same as hash_to_ec32 |
64-char hex | Deprecated alias — use hash_to_ec32 or hash_to_ec160 explicitly |
Both hash_to_ec* helpers run cn_fast_hash(pub) → ge_fromfe → ge_mul8; they differ only in whether the result is serialized as ge_p3 (160 bytes) or compressed (32 bytes).
Port of crypto_ops::generate_signature / generate_ring_signature (conceal-core C++).
| Function | Parameters | Returns |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
generate_signature(prefix_hex, pub_hex, sec_hex) |
64-char hex hash + key pair | 128-char hex signature | Standard CN signature (c || r) |
generate_ring_signature(prefix_hex, image_hex, pubs_hex[], sec_hex, sec_index) |
prefix, key image, array of ring pub keys, secret, signer index | string[] of 128-char hex sigs |
One signature per ring member |
check_signature(prefix_hex, pub_hex, sig_hex) |
hash, public key, 128-char hex signature | boolean |
|
check_ring_signature(prefix_hex, image_hex, pubs_hex[], sigs_hex[]) |
same as generate + signature array | boolean |
sec_hex must be canonical (sc_check). For ring signatures, key_image_hex must equal generate_key_image(pubs_hex[sec_index], sec_hex).
Rust unit tests verify generate → check round-trips against the same C crypto-ops paths (not the full tests.txt vectors, which assume a fixed PRNG offset after thousands of prior tests).
| Function | Parameters | Returns |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
create_address(seed_hex) |
64-char hex seed | { spend: {sec, pub}, view: {sec, pub}, public_addr: string } |
Monero-compatible: view = generate_keys(cn_fast_hash(spend.sec)) |
decode_address(address) |
Base58 Conceal address string | { spend: hex, view: hex, intPaymentId: null } |
Validates checksum; throws on invalid prefix or checksum |
| Constant | Value |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Address prefix | 31444 (varint d4f501) |
Standard CCX mainnet address |
| Integrated address prefix | 31445 |
Payment-ID address |
| Subaddress prefix | 31446 |
Subaddress |
| Address checksum | first 4 bytes of cn_fast_hash(prefix + spend + view) |
Embedded in every address |
Stream ciphers — encrypt and decrypt are the same operation (XOR with keystream). IETF nonce format: 32-byte key + 12-byte nonce + 32-bit counter starting at 0.
| Function | Parameters | Returns |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
chacha8(key, nonce, data) |
key: Uint8Array[32]; nonce: Uint8Array[12]; data: Uint8Array |
Uint8Array |
ChaCha8 (8 rounds). Throws on wrong key/nonce size |
chacha12(key, nonce, data) |
key: Uint8Array[32]; nonce: Uint8Array[12]; data: Uint8Array |
Uint8Array |
ChaCha12 (12 rounds). Throws on wrong key/nonce size |
